These predictions are not very related to any alignment research that is currently occurring. I think it’s just quite unclear how hard the problem is, e.g. does deceptive alignment occur, do models trained to honestly answer easy questions generalize to hard questions, how much intellectual work are AI systems doing before they can take over, etc.
I know people have spilled a lot of ink over this, but right now I don’t have much sympathy for confidence that the risk will be real and hard to fix (just as I don’t have much sympathy for confidence that the problem isn’t real or will be easy to fix).
